Re: [T3] clicking VR and gen light on


>Get a new Bosch 30-019 VR.

Thanks Jim.  While buying the VR (above $26.23), I remembered my gen. brushes were
"low", so I spent $2.50 as backup.  I've been keeping my eye on them since I bought the
car 8 years ago, but hadn't looked in awhile.  Sure enough they were down to the
pigtails.  I replaced them right there in the parking lot, and driving to work the
clicking and light are gone!  Is the VR still on it's way out?  Otherwise I've now got a
spare VR.
